Health Right Volume II Issue 4 Summer 1976 documents feminist health activism and labor-focused critiques of workplace safety in the United States following the establishment of federal occupational health regulation. Produced in New York by the Women's Health Forum/Health Right Inc. the issue supports research into women's health movements labor feminism and grassroots responses to the Occupational Safety and Health Act. The publication centers women workers' experiences in industries such as garment production healthcare clerical work and manufacturing presenting occupational health as a gendered issue shaped by segregation wage inequality and limited regulatory enforcement.<br /> Health Right Collective. Health Right. New York: Women's Health Forum/Health Right Inc. Summer 1976. Volume II Issue 4. Tabloid format. The lead article "Labor Pains: Occupational Health in America" by Sharon Liberian and the collective appears on the front page alongside historical images of women garment workers and the Triangle Shirtwaist Factory fire. The article connects early twentieth-century industrial disasters to contemporary workplace conditions analyzing hazards including toxic exposure unsafe machinery repetitive strain and production speedup. The "Labor Voices" section presents firsthand testimony from women workers addressing discrimination low wages and the limited effectiveness of unions and federal oversight. Additional content includes the editorial "The Year of the Cutback" which critiques reductions in public health funding; commentary on divisions within the Feminist Women's Health Center network; "Health News Briefs" summarizing research on contraception and sterilization; regional organizing reports; and resource listings for feminist literature and educational materials addressing abortion menopause childbirth sexual violence and breast cancer. The issue integrates activist analysis with practical information reflecting the organizing priorities of mid-1970s feminist health networks.<br /> <br /> 8 pages. 1919189681919. Survey of Relief to Widows and Children Presented to Parliament by Command of His Majesty. Ministry of Health. 186 pages. London: His Majesty's Stationary Office 1919. Measures 9.5" x 6." Issued under the rule of George V a champion of welfare reform and social work. A landmark government report on post-World War I welfare policy documenting the scope administration and social implications of public assistance to widows and dependent children in Britain. Issued by the Ministry of Health and presented to Parliament in the immediate aftermath of the war this 186-page survey represents one of the earliest comprehensive attempts to analyze the treatment and conditions of war widows and impoverished families under the Poor Law system and other charitable schemes. The report is presented in dense statistical tables and detailed narrative assessments distinguishing between rural and urban jurisdictions and evaluating the differential treatment of illegitimate children and the moral assumptions underlying state relief. As stated in the Survey's prefatory note the decision to publish a report on the well-being of windows and children arose after a 1914 House of Lords case in which a poor mother was convicted of child cruelty. The woman whose earnings were 10 shillings a week locked her children in a rented room "where they were found in an indescribable state and in a mental condition bordering upon idiocy." The mother said she did not want to seek governmental assistance for fear that her family would be separated. This resulting survey examines the efficacy of Britain's social safety net as well as that of the United States. It contains case studies investigations and inspections. Examines Latino family structures social service access and mental health policy in the United States through a coordinated body of scholarly and advocacy writing produced during the post Civil Rights period. The volume supports research into Latinx social policy development Chicano studies and the emergence of culturally specific frameworks in public health and human services. Issued under the auspices of the National Coalition of Hispanic Mental Health and Human Services Organizations the work brings together contributions addressing systemic inequality acculturation pressures and institutional exclusion with sustained attention to how federal and local programs failed to accommodate linguistic cultural and familial structures within Hispanic communities.<br /> <br /> Montiel Miguel ed. Hispanic Families: Critical Issues for Policy and Programs in Human Services. Washington D.C.: The National Coalition of Hispanic Mental Health and Human Services Organizations 1978. First edition. Perfect-bound in original cream-colored wrappers printed in brown with illustrations depicting Latino family life. The text is organized as a multi-author collection engaging topics including intergenerational caregiving patterns bilingual education and communication barriers urban Chicano identity formation and dependency networks within extended families. Several essays address culturally competent service delivery outlining the limitations of standardized welfare and mental health models when applied to Spanish-speaking populations. Contributors frame family units as central sites of continuity and adaptation while also identifying institutional practices that marginalize or fragment these structures. The publication advances policy recommendations grounded in community-specific experience rather than assimilationist assumptions.<br /> <br /> Single volume; pagination not stated. This work was sponsored jointly by FAO and WHO with the support of the International Programme on Chemical Safety IPCS. This volume contains toxicological monographs that were prepared by the 1998 Joint FAO/WHO Meeting on Prsticide Residues JMPR. The monographs in this volume summarize the safety data on 12 pesticides that have the potential to leave residues in food commodities. These pesticides are: amitraz; bentazone; bitertanol; dicloran; dinocap; diphenylamine; endosulfan; ethoxyquin; kresoxim-methyl; methiocarb; phosmet; and thiophanate-methyl.
